One thing i have noticed that is problematic with the +100% reinforcement range is that some of the turn 1 starting battles are a hostile AI army and a nearby hostile AI city.
However with this mod now BOTH the AI army and the AI city are pulled together into the same fight, which makes some campaign starts borderline impossible because you are fighting 2 battles at the same time with your turn 1 army.
Also the +100% reinforcement range will sometimes pull armies across mountains in those narrow terrains around greenskin/skaven territories, leads to some really odd situations where an army that is not visually close to a city is reinforcing it.
Perhaps the bonus could please be reduced to +50% (so its total is 150%) and it would still be very strong.

You will see my mod and there's a line that says reinforcement_radius = 2 The original value of the game is 1, and the one that i used before was 5. So you can pick how much radius you want :)
